Patek Philippe. A fine and unusual 18K gold rectangular hinged wristwatch with flared sides and Breguet numerals
Signed Patek Philippe & Co., Genève, movement no. 811'177, case no. 290'391, manufactured in 1925
Cal. 10''' circular nickel-finished jewelled lever movement, bimetallic compensation balance, wolf's tooth winding, silvered matte dial, applied gold Breguet numerals, outer railway minute divisions, subsidiary seconds, rectangular case, flared sides, hinged back, case, dial and movement signed
25.5 mm. wide & 37 mm. overall length

专家说明

With Patek Philippe Extract from the Archives confirming production of the present watch with rectangular tortoise-shape case, silvered dial and applied gold hour markers in 1925 and its subsequent sale on 20 October 1926.

The present lot is one of only four examples of such Patek Philippe "tortoise-shaped" wristwatch known to exist to date and furthermore believed to be the only one featuring Breguet numerals.

The model is distinguished by its distinct Art Deco design. Denominated "rectangular, tortoise shape" in the workbooks of Patek Philippe, the shape of the case resembles a turtle, a very popular animal during this era and symbol of good fortune and longevity in many civilisations.
